Frequency For The Musically Non-Inclined? |
|
Is Frequency a game that anybody with horrible music skills should be playing? I'm interested in trying it, but I'm afraid that I'm going to spend $40 on a game that I'm just going to end up scratching my head over. Kind of like when I try to play a guitar. LOL.

You need to have fast fingers, and a good beat in your head. The controls take a smidge to get used to. But I suggest starting out with Parappa The Rapper 1, PSX or 2, PS2 (although 2 is slightly easier) The Um Jammer Lammy, PSX. Then go to Samba De Amigo for DC.(Or Bust-a- Groove, PSX). Then you should rent Frequency. If you like what you hear, buy it...

Man this game is very difficult. I have been playing this for hours, and still not fully used to it. Cannot move my fingers fast enough, and get out of sync. Press the middle instead of the 3rd note etc. LOL.
But this game is well worth buying and heaps of fun. My scores are slowly increasing, so I guess I am slowly improving. The track is very much like a musical stave, only laying flat, and looks the same same as a musical stave, and divided in the same way. I guess it also comes down to memorizing the song, and it's beat also. If only my fingers could move fast enough.
